If you see the part of the video were he has the rod and reel combo laying inside the boat you can see exactly how we has the hook set up. Its a drop shot rig with a huge treble hook, and he probably put the grub just to disguise it a little bit from people. And at the beggining when he is fishing in front of a tree you can clearly see that he spots a fish and then tries to snag it. There is no defending him.1 point -

So got the 3 I did finished up today, and a quick photo shoot in the yard. Interesting to see how much wood varies in weight. All these baits were from from the same batch of Spanish cedar. You can see the lightest one weighs 2.37oz, this piece in particular was incredibly light weight and had a strip of very soft wood, you can see the thick burnt line, that’s the soft wood. the skirted one weighed in at 2.45oz and super dense one weighs 3.35oz, almost a full oz over the lightest one. they are all weighed the same, and rigged the same as far as hook/rings/tails. Then some glamour shots before I fish the hell out of this week, got a 4 day trip on Thursday1 point
